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_032256.3(TMEM117):c.1267C>T(p.Arg423Cys) variant causes a missense change. The variant allele was found at a frequency of 0.000307 in 1,613,208 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
TMEM117 (HGNC:25308): (transmembrane protein 117) Involved in intrinsic apoptotic signaling pathway in response to endoplasmic reticulum stress. Located in endoplasmic reticulum and plasma membrane.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sFeb 23, 2023The c.1267C>T (p.R423C) alteration is located in exon 8 (coding exon 7) of the TMEM117 gene. This alteration results from a C to T substitution at nucleotide position 1267, causing the arginine (R) at amino acid position 423 to be replaced by a cysteine (C).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
